If small local health departments can’t apply, can regions apply? Or must state health apply?

0

Local health departments (city, county etc.) that do not serve the cities listed in the eligibility requirement are not eligible to apply. States are eligible applicants. Applicants are encouraged to consult with their legal counsel to determine if they are eligible to apply as bona fide agents.
